The all-new Geely Binyue Pro has introduced a four-cylinder engine. The Binyue is an SUV model under Geely's 'Bin' series. Below are the specific details of the Geely Binyue Pro: 1. Exterior: The entire lineup has been upgraded to sporty models. Geely has also equipped it with a two-tone body, an oversized sporty rear spoiler, carbon fiber mirror decorations, and 18-inch tomahawk-style blackened sporty wheels, giving the vehicle a commanding presence. 2. Interior: The interior features a black and red color scheme, a combination typically found in supercars. It is equipped with Geely's latest GKUI-19 Geek Intelligent Ecosystem. 3. Powertrain: The most significant change in the Binyue Pro is the introduction of a new 1.4T engine alongside the retained 1.5T high-power version. The 1.4T engine delivers a maximum horsepower of 141 hp and a peak torque of 235 Nm, paired with a 6-speed dual-clutch transmission.
